• Short Circuit – Prevents drive failure if a short circuit occurs at the motor (phase-to-phase).
• Motor Filter – Reduces harmful voltage spikes to the motor.
• Regeneration – Eliminates nuisance tripping due to bus overvoltage caused by rapid decel-
eration of high inertial loads.
• Undervoltage and Overvoltage – Shuts down the drive if the AC line input voltage goes
above or below the operating range.
• MOV Input Transient Suppression.
• Microcontroller Self Monitoring and Auto-Reboot.
3.4 Trimpot Adjustments
• Minimum Speed (MIN) –
Sets the minimum speed of the motor. See Sec. 13.1, on pg. 39.
• Maximum Speed (MAX) – Sets the maximum speed of the motor. See Sec. 13.2, on pg. 39.
• Acceleration (ACC) – Sets the amount of time for the motor to accelerate from zero speed
to full speed. See Section 13.3, on page 39.
• Deceleration (DEC/B) – Sets the amount of time for the motor to decelerate from full speed
to zero speed. See Section 13.4, on pages 39 and 40.
• Slip Compensation (COMP) – Maintains set motor speed under varying loads. See Section
13.5, on pages 40 and 41.
• Boost (DEC/B) – In 50 Hz mode, the trimpot automatically becomes Adjustable Boost,
which can be used to set the Volts/Hz Curve for 50 Hz motors to obtain maximum perform-
ance. In 50 Hz Mode, the deceleration time is automatically set to the same as the accelera-
tion time. See Section 13.6, on pages 41 and 42.
• Current Limit (CL) – Sets the current limit (overload) which limits the maximum current
(torque) to the motor. See Section 13.7, on pages 42 and 43.
